How MIPS and board certification work

The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

Awilda Solis Diaz, M.D. appears in the CMS NPPES registry as a General Practice Physician provider holding M.D. credentials at CRISTOBAL COLON ST, Yabucoa, PR, 00767, with a listed phone of (787) 893-8204. NPI 1972658516 was issued on 01/24/2007.

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 21,293 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 584 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$965K in drug spend, split 11% brand-name and 88% generic by claim count.

General Practice Physician is a mid-sized specialty nationwide, with 16,725 enrolled providers across 56 states and an average of 2,872 Part D claims per prescriber, so the context for interpreting these metrics differs meaningfully from a primary-care baseline.

Limitations
Provider data is self-reported to CMS. Prescribing data reflects Medicare Part D only and does not include commercial insurance, Medicaid, or cash prescriptions. Claims below 11 beneficiaries are suppressed by CMS for privacy.
